
( Brand: Fasco ), ( Manufacturer Part Number: 7108-5111 ), ( Part Type: Motor ), ( Model Number: U8b1 7108-5111 ), ( Power: 1/20 Hp ), ( Rpm: 1550 Rpm ), ( Shaft Od: 12 Mm ), ( Voltage: 115 V-ac ), ( Phase: 1ph ), ( Reference Sku: 1753858 ), ( Product Condition: Used Excellent )
